Ex 20:16 –‘you shall not give false testimony against your neighbor’

 

He is a handsome and charming undercover cop with the mission to extract information from the vulnerable and beautiful girl. Under the disguise of his winning smile he takes her out for a romantic dinner and during a late night moonlit walk along the river front she finally ends up telling him what he was looking for. If you’ve seen this movie, or another one just like it, you know what is next: She finds out what he is really after and is furious, hurt and runs away. By this time he has fallen in love with her and runs after her to prove to her that he is not who she thinks he is. Did you know that Hollywood mimics the story of Jacob? This Sunday, as we continue our series on the Ten Commandments, we will discover how Jacob lied and twisted the truth, and it ended up costing him dearly. How did God save him from all of this? Let’s find out this Sunday as we look at ‘Honest to God’
